摘要

A beam control system for irradiation treatment gated by respiration of a patient has been developed at HIMAC to minimize an unwanted irradiation to normal tissues around tumor. The system employs rf-knockout extraction with gate function. Preliminary experimental results, which were carried out with moving phantom and simulating signal of respiration, are encouraging.
机译:HIMAC已开发出一种用于通过患者的呼吸进行门控的辐射治疗的束控制系统,以最大程度地减少对肿瘤周围正常组织的有害辐射。该系统采用带门功能的rf-knockout提取。通过移动体模并模拟呼吸信号进行的初步实验结果令人鼓舞。
